In the near future, we will be introducing a resolution to celebrate the Dauphin County Library System on its 100th anniversary. On January 1, 1914, the Harrisburg Public Library first opened its doors to thousands of eager citizens. Today that library, along with seven others, comprises the Dauphin County Library System. In 2012, the Dauphin County Library System welcomed more than 771,000 visitors, lent more than 1.25 million items to its 119,430 cardholders. To celebrate the 100th birthday, the Dauphin County Library System will be hosting an event on April 12, 2014.
